>>>>I got this error "Not enough memory for file map" when I tried to add a field to table structure. I got like 4 giga of memory. And I think the 3 memo fields in the table has something to do with the error. the FPT file seems somewhat having some corrupted data.
>>>>There are like 50 different tables in the Database. Only one table is giving me the error.
>>>>
>>>>I can't add field to or delete field from the the table. I tried PACK , it ran without problem. But I am still getting the error when trying to
>>>>add a field to the table. The table has 51 fields, record length: 484
>>>>Is there any way to clean up the fpt file ?
>>>>
>>>>Thanks in advance.
>>>>
>>>>Kam Lee
>>>>SUNY DMC
>>>>Brooklyn NY
>>>
>>>Try suggestions from this blog post Not enough memory for a file map
>>>
>>>SYS(3050, 1, 512*1024*1024)
>>>SYS(3050, 2, 512*1024*1024)
>>Thanks Namoi for the reply. I just tried the SYS(3050, 2, 1.5*1024*1024*1024) and ?SYS(3050, 1, 1.5*1024*1024*1024)
>>it did not work. Got the same error. Windows taskmanger showing vfp is using 1 giga of memory.
>>The table is about 467 mega byte large though. The fpt is about 400 mega.
>
>Try less memory, 512*1024 as suggested in the blog.
It works. Thanks Naomi!!
